So your question... I sort of chalk it up to one of those things that proves life wouldn’t be any fun if we all agreed on everything or had the same travel opinions/preferences. I am certainly in the minority around here when it comes to BWI, so I’m the oddball.
I think most of it is that BWI as a resort just doesn’t speak to us all that much. Love the location, the theme and layout isn’t my favorite. The pool is fine, we just like others better. No zero entry pool and no true kids splash pad are dings (my kids are younger). I’m not one to be too concerned with room style, but the rooms are sort of Grandma’s house’ish for my taste (love you Grandma!).
While this can happen anywhere, we had a bout of crowded lounge conditions during our stay. Seemed like every time we tried for evening apps there was nowhere to sit. In fairness, this was during the Princess Half Marathon weekend, which I sometimes think inspires more folks hanging around the lounges given early wake up calls.
Food and beverage were great and worthy of the high praise they consistently receive on the thread. I did find the cooking odors in the evening odd (it’s pretty overpowering all over the halls depending on what’s cooking), but I don’t really count that as a big deal.
We didn’t experience any CM interactions or attentiveness that were different than any other CL (if anything it might have been below-average), but that is also often mentioned as a major highlight around here.
I love this thread, but sometimes I think I let the chatter build expectations too much in my head for some CLs before trying them. I think it happened to us for BWI, like it happened for GF RPC. Both nice resorts and CLs... but at the end of the day, just Disney CLs - complete with their various pros and cons.
Full disclosure - we only have one BWI CL stay, Feb 2018, so that has some age to it. We were there for an adults only trip and were really excited to try it as we had a vision that it would be a great spot with no kids, but left with the conclusion that we just like other places better. I think one stay isn’t enough to make a fair assessment so I do hope to return someday, just haven’t found the right trip to do it again.
